The question

Is it permissible for a girl to practice religious rites with the exception of the hijab?

The answer

A Muslim must completely submit to Allah and adhere to all His commands, while shunning disobedience. Allah has enjoined the hijab upon women. If a woman is compelled to abandon the hijab due to coercion, she must remain in her home, in accordance with the Almighty's saying: "And remain in your houses." If she is then forced to go out without a hijab, we hope there will be no sin upon her, due to the Almighty's saying: "So fear Allah as much as you are able." It is not permissible for one who is unable to fulfill a religious command to be lenient regarding other commands.
